  • Congratulations to Brett Powell, SACUBO board member and co-chair of the Professional Development Committee! Tarleton State Names Dr. Brett Powell CFO, Executive Vice President for Finance and Administration Tarleton State University has named Dr. Brett Powell the new Chief Financial Officer and Executive Vice President for Finance and Administration, effective July 1. In this role, Dr. Powell will oversee Tarleton State’s budgetary and fiscal affairs, including planning, monitoring and managing overall financial plans, policies and operations. “Dr. Powell is a proven leader in all aspects of financial services, making him a tremendous fit for the growth trajectory of our institution,” said Tarleton State President Dr. James Hurley. “He will be an invaluable resource as we strive to be the premier comprehensive university in the nation.” https://lnkd.in/gz6XYrJf

  • 2024 John D. Walda Pathfinder Award from NACUBO Congratulations to Dr. Ronald Rhames! This year, NACUBO’s Board of Directors bestowed its highest honor, the John D. Walda Pathfinder Award, on Dr. Ronald Rhames, president emeritus of Midlands Technical College (SC). Since 2012, the award has been given only four times, to individuals whose lives and careers in higher education business management are inspirations to college and university business officers. An employee of Midlands Technical College for 34 years, Rhames became the first African American president in its history in 2015 and led many successful initiatives, including those aimed at making the college more affordable. He also implemented a comprehensive strategic planning process and restructured the college’s academic and continuing education programs into guided pathways for students. Rhames served as chair of the NACUBO Board of Directors and president of the regional association SACUBO, among other roles. In addition to the Pathfinder Award, Rhames has received numerous accolades, including the State of South Carolina’s highest civilian honor, the Order of the Palmetto, in recognition of his impact and service.

  • Congratulations to Steve Kimata on the 2024 NACUBO Student Financial Services Award! Steve Kimata, associate vice president for enrollment and student financial services at the University of Virginia, received the 2024 Student Financial Services Award for his many contributions to his institution, the profession, and NACUBO. His extensive experience includes 40 years at the University of Virginia, serving in roles including bursar and controller.

  • Congratulations to Kelvin Davis for receiving the 2024 NACUBO Rising Star Award! Kelvin Davis, Delta State University associate vice president of finance and administration and deputy CFO, received the 2024 Rising Star Award in recognition of his high potential to succeed as an executive and business officer in higher education. At Delta State, he has managed general accounting, grant accounting, accounts payable, procurement, financial reporting, treasury, bursar, payroll, budgeting, and the university’s contracted auxiliaries. He is a 2023-24 participant in the NACUBO Fellows Program and is active in regional association SACUBO as well. Kelvin is the chair of the comprehensive and doctoral constituent committee for SACUBO.
